#DIY #Miniature #Spring Greenhouse | Part 2 #Tutorial

This little greenhouse deserves some décor inside and out! To create the background, I traced the mini cabinet onto a piece of the Among the Wildflowers 12x12 paper. I then measured out the width of the wood siding and cut out the inner piece to create a paper background perfectly sized to fit in the back window, which I attached with a few dots of glue in some strategic places. The top windows were covered in the same way but with the vellum sheet from the 6x8 paper pad.

Then I glued moulds I painted with watercolors to the back of this miniature greenhouse with some Heavy Body Gel. I added all the potted plants I created, added some spilled dirt made from coffee grounds in front of the knocked over pots, some itty bitty spools of yarn, and a chipboard sticker to the inside.

On the outside, I added some bird moulds and larger paper flowers to the roofline, pom pom trim along the top, and a vellum butterfly and bee from the Among the Wildflowers Vellum Ephemera pack.
